North Pattaya Condo Causes a Stink With Pattaya City Hall

Khun Viravat, senior Trade Officer and a deputy mayor of Pattaya led a delegation of Pattaya City Hall Officials with the city Sanitation Engineering to sniff out a long standing problem in North Pattaya. The offensive problem was not too difficult to find as an offensive smell permanently permeates the pristine sea breezes that should be wafting through the area.

Local residents of soi 16 in Naklua North Pattaya have been increasingly vocal in their complaints of the increasingly bad smells coming from the nether regions of The High Rise Laguna Heights Condo. Khun Viravat and his entourage had a chat with some of the local residents and took note of their complaints and concerns and assured them that Pattaya City Hall would speedily sort out the smelly situation.

A meeting later with Condo management highlighted the problems that were causing the pongy pollution. Pumps at the condo building were coping with extracting the excremental sewage but were not able to transfer the resultant rancid waste water into the local drainage system leading to leakages. The condo management said that they had a three phase plan to fix the problem starting with new pumps and sewage control systems.

Khun Viravat passed on the concerned local residents concerns and said that his team of Sanitation engineers would pay regular visits to the area to ensure that The condo was following up on it's promises to deal with this problem.
